Offering an anthropological perspective, this book delves into migration and transnationalism through both macro and micro lenses. Brettell draws on her extensive fieldwork in Portugal and beyond to explore critical themes such as immigrant incorporation, the effects on individuals and communities, illegal immigration, and ethnic entrepreneurship. She also examines the roles of gender and religion in migration, as well as the significance of oral histories in shaping social boundaries. This work is essential for scholars in various fields including anthropology and sociology.
